When is the best time for a budget trip to Dunshaughlin?
Weather is probably a major factor when you plan your trip to Dunshaughlin,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Dunshaughlin is 814 mm.

How can I get to Dunshaughlin and get around on a budget?
Scoping out the transportation options in Dunshaughlin is a smart way to keep your trip affordable. The closest airport is Dublin Airport (DUB), 13.7 mi (22.1 km) away. Dunshaughlin might not have very many public transport choices so a rental car could be a reasonable alternative to explore the area.
